Obasanjo says Buhari’s integrity is fake, Atiku is more presidential

Posted on

Former President Olusegun Obasanjo has said the touted integrity of President Muhammadu Buhari is doubtful while describing the anti-graft war of the ruling All Progressives Congress (APC) as a charade.

Obasanjo was speaking at the 2019 quarterly business lecture organised by the Island Club of Lagos, where he vouched for the presidential cand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Alhaji Atiku Abubakar’s ability to move the country forward.

“Have I ever said a lie? Has everything I said concerning the former vice president or the present incumbent not been proven beyond any shadow of doubt? Nigerians must rise up to defend our fledgling democracy; nobody would do this for us.

“There is no better person to lead Nigerians out of the present problems that have been created than Atiku. Some people claim to be fighting corruption when they have corruption right on their nose, they claimed to have integrity and we can all see that it is a lie.

“Unlike some others, Atiku has never claimed to be a saint or a messiah. When I said someone was not a messiah some years ago, some people were up in arms. As a Christian, the only messiah I know is Jesus Christ. A leader must be honest to himself and the people he wants to serve and be served. I believe Atiku has these qualities.

“A good leader must identify mistakes, show remorse, seek forgiveness and repent, and not pass the buck to others. Atiku has asked for my forgiveness and I forgave him as my religion tells me to,” Obasanjo said.

The former president added that if elected as president, Atiku Abubakar will not be a sectional president as he will be president for all.

“This is the difference between Atiku and the incumbent. He will be a team leader and not be controlled by any cabal as we are currently witnessing.”
